The "Nur" name for the R34 GT-R is more ascociated with the lightened pistons, rods, and "balanced" engine that are common with the Nurburgring 24hour GT-R race car, and the Super Taikyu Race car, than with the standard GT-R's laptime around the 'Ring. I think Nissan was trying to pay tribute to the GT-R's connection with Nurburgring, rather than boast about a quick laptime.

  16. >Nameless EJ6: I can understand your confusion man, that turbo RB25 probably WAS taken out of a GTS-4... Check the second car down on this site... It was a GTS-4, but now the owner proudly hails that it's a "GTS-4t", or a mini GT-R. He had a turbo and manifold from a RB25DET bolted on to his RB25DE. So, there were no GTS-4t's officially, the owners modified their GTS-4's to turbo spec.
